Design: The JBL Clip 5 is light and compact, weighing in at 285g. It will come with a carabiner hooked up, making it handy for listening in all kinds of eventualities. An IP67 score suggests it's waterproof and rugged adequate for outdoor get-togethers or vacations. Its visual appeal feels a little dated, however, and it struggles to stand on its base �?that's why the carabiner is so necessary.
